I have a 92 Lexus SC400/Soarer with the switch on rather normal or higher air suspention, it works and when i flick it to high the car raises maybe an inch, is that all the standard raise it is meant to do?? Doesnt seem like much difference is it normal?

Its use is typically to help you negotiate steeper driveway or parking ramp entries and similar things, not to put you on stalks for bush-bashing. It seems quite effective for its purpose, in my case making the necessary difference to avoid scraping entering the garage (sloping driveway) at my previous house. I had to remember though, to flick the switch when I turned into our street to allow the necessary half minute for it to be ready.
